Russian president’s decree equates digital identity documents with paper versions

Russians will be able to present a digital identity document from “Gosuslugi” instead of a paper passport⁠

The decree of the President of the Russian Federation from 18.09.2023 № 695 “On the presentation of information contained in identity documents of a citizen of the Russian Federation, using information technology” regulates the use of digital versions of documents posted on “Gosuslugi”.

This initiative has been introduced to enhance public convenience. As per the President’s directive, the concerned ministries, in collaboration with the Federal Security Service (FSS), will specify the documents that can be presented via a mobile application on smartphones within a three-month period. Additionally, protocols for the utilization and processing of the provided information will be established.

Citizens on a voluntary basis will be able to provide documents via the mobile app.

In early 2023, Maksut Shadaev, who heads the Ministry of Digital Development, put forward a proposal to create a digital identity card based on the portal of state services. Vladimir Putin approved the minister’s initiative and suggested speeding up the process.
